What Google Means to Energy Google has invested $780 million in renewable energy generation and tech development Google boasts themselves as being a neutral carbon company, offsetting as much CO 2 as they produce The G-mail system is said to be 80% more efficient than company in-house service

Outline -Google’s overall Carbon footprint calculation if all of their energy was from power plants -Google’s wind and solar offsets -The things we don’t think about (What would the world be like without Google) -What is the carbon footprint of this project???

Assumptions -All the power is coming from coal power plant. -Account for all of Google searchers, Gmail and YouTube usage and all other Google applications. -Average trip to the library is 1.5 miles each way. -70% of bituminous coal is Carbon. -Everyone used Google to complete their project

Conclusion -Online activity is increasing significantly each year. -Google is pushing toward more renewable energy sources. -If Google didn’t pursue more efficient equipment and methods CO 2 footprint would DOUBLE. -Google also contributes in the development of renewable energy and technology. -Yahoo doesn’t release their energy information.
